What is Global Digital Futures?


Global Digital Futures is an organization focused on empowering and platforming technology and digital media with a Global South focus. Originally envisioned by Chipo Mapondera in 2018 while a student at SOAS, it was initially a technology-focused podcast produced in collaboration with SOAS Radio. Today, Global Digital Futures has come a long way and following the success of GDF Think Tank on YouTube the organization has changed into a ā€˜home’ for digital media art projects with an Africa focus.

What to check out!


Starting in November 2023 the Global Digital Futures team has been presenting their award winning digital media art installation ā€œFuturistic Paganā€.

Futuristic Pagan is a virtual reality experience connecting fashion, nature and spirituality, in a Zezuru traditional dreamscape. It presents the fashion collection, designed using 3D modelling techniques by Sabina Mutsvati, to elevate the traditional Hanga and Retso fabrics. The virtual reality experience, designed and built by Chipo Mapondera, explores our connection to the ancestral realm through nature. The hut, Imba yaAmai becomes the fashion showroom and site of matriarchal hierarchy and metaphysical meaning.
